Dive into the rich tapestry of Greek music with George Dalaras' "I Simmetohes," a comprehensive collection released on December 8, 2014, under the Minos - EMI SA label. This expansive album spans an impressive 3 hours and 5 minutes, featuring a diverse array of 46 tracks that showcase the depth and breadth of George Dalaras' artistic prowess. The album is a masterclass in laïko and entehno genres, offering a blend of traditional and contemporary sounds that highlight Dalaras' enduring influence in the world of Greek music.
From the hauntingly beautiful "Ta Veggalika Sou Matia" to the lively "Atzeda," each track is a testament to Dalaras' ability to capture the essence of Greek culture and storytelling. The album includes remastered versions of beloved classics like "Taxidi Sta Kithira" and "Oi Stathmarches," providing fans with a fresh perspective on timeless favorites. Live performances such as "Kapia Kapou Kapote" and "Gineka" offer a glimpse into Dalaras' dynamic stage presence, while tracks like "Everlasting" and "Ohi Den Ine Himera" showcase his versatility and range.

George Dalaras, born in 1949, is a legendary Greek singer and musician renowned for his profound impact on Greek music. With a career spanning decades, Dalaras has masterfully blended laïko and entehno genres, making him one of the most prominent figures in Greek music. His repertoire is a rich tapestry of rembetiko, Greek folk music, and Latin American influences, showcasing his versatility and deep connection to his cultural roots. Dalaras' powerful vocals and emotive performances have earned him a dedicated global following. Beyond his musical achievements, he is also a Goodwill Ambassador for the UN Refugee Agency, using his platform to advocate for important causes.
